The case of Marginalised Victorian women: An analysis of Charles Dickens’s Oliver Twist and hard times through Kate millett’s feminism

The present dissertation aims to analyse Victorian society and its reflection in the 19th-century novels such as Hard Times and Oliver Twist within the feminist framework. Discriminative attitudes in a patriarchal society and how females meet abuse from childhood are among the main concerns; therefore, these are also examined with a great emphasis and added to the research. Their miserable condition inspires the author of this study to shed light upon the women and children within their fictionalisation both in the Victorian novels and in different periods. Kate Millett’s Sexual Politics is considered the secondary source to develop ideas and explain the quotes taken from the mentioned novels. She discusses the inequality between sexes stemming from the religious, psychological, and historical mistreatment of women. The research is mainly based on the analysis of deprived groups such as women and children; thus, Charles Dickens’s masterpieces are used as evidence supporting the main idea of this work because he is one of the significant novelists of the Victorian Era for his realistic illustrations of society.
